Who has put forward the 'Law of
Minimum'?Solution
The Law of Minimum, proposed by Justus von Liebig, states that the growth and yield of a crop are determined by the essential nutrient that is in the shortest supply. In other words, the availability of nutrients is like a chain, and the growth of plants is limited by the scarcest nutrient, not the total amount of nutrients present.
